The 2018 Sundance Film Festival is nearly upon us, and we’ll soon have coverage of the newest indie movies on the scene making their debut in the mountains of Park City, Utah. One of our more anticipated movies in the line-up has just debuted an awesome new teaser trailer.
Summer of ‘84is the latest film fromRKSS(orFrançois Simard, Anouk Whissell, andYoann-Karl Whissell), the filmmakers behind the cult favoriteTurbo Kid, and the first teaser trailer paints a picture that is clearly going for aStranger Thingsvibe, but with a little more of a sinister style. While there’s a bit of an Amblin-esque thing going on here, the subject matter is a little darker as a group of teens gets caught up in the mystery of a serial killer terrorizing their suburban town back in 1984.

The 1980s setting, the sarcastic group of friends, the discussion aboutStar Wars– these are all things that get me excited to see this movie. Combine that with the fact that it’s about a group of teens trying to determine whether their next door neighbor, a police officer played byMad MenstarRich Sommer, is a serial killer, and this sounds like an indie hit in the making.
The rest of the cast includesGraham Verchere,Judah Lewis,Caleb Emery,Cory Gruter-Andrew,Tiera Skovbye,Jason Gray-Stanford, andShauna Johannesen. While indie movies often feature up-and-coming talent instead of big names, this casting has an even greater effect here since it makes this movie seem like a relic from the 1980s that has been lying undiscovered for decades.
